This is my husband's area of expertise, so I asked him (as David Eddings is his favorite author). Assuming you've read the Belgariad, Mallorean, Tamuli, Elenium and Dreamers series from Eddings, other similar writers to try are:

Terry Goodkind (Sword of Truth series),

Anne McCaffrey (Pern series)

Terry Brooks (Shannara)

Raymond E Feist (Riftwar saga)

R. A. Salvatore (Drizzt )

Robert Jordan (Wheel of Time)

Melanie Rawn (Exiles, Dragon Prince and Dragon Star series)

That should keep you busy for a while as there are multiple books in each series, they are all on my husband's keepers list. Feel free to PM me if you have any other questions .....
